Frequently asked questions Q1: Why does the article not consider Bongbong Marcos as a graduate of a degree at Oxford University?
A1: A large amount of material and Oxford University themselves have stated that Bongbong Marcos did not graduate with a full degree and was only given a special diploma. Q2: Why does this article use
Rappler as a source of information?
A2: Rappler is considered a
reliable source according to the consensus of
multiple discussions about Rappler on the
reliable sources noticeboard (see discussions
1,
2, and
3). This however, does not include Rappler's
Voices section, which contains
crowdsourced
opinion pieces. As such, articles from Rappler's other sections do not pose any issues with the article's
neutral point of view or Wikipedia's policy on
original research. |
